This super speedy guacamole vinaigrette is a great addition to any salad, but here we’ve paired it with romaine (a hearty green will stand up better to the rich dressing), peppers, tomatoes, red onion, and grilled halloumi. Halloumi—a firm, brined cheese from Cyprus—has a high melting point ,so it is excellent when quickly seared. The crisp exteriors gives way to an almost melted interior, and it has a pleasantly squeaky quality.

Halloumi Salad with Guacamole Vinaigrette
Prep Time: 15 minutes
Active Time: 15 minutes
Serving Size: Serves 4
Ingredients:
1 (8-ounce) tray WHOLLY GUACAMOLE®
1 tablespoon (15 ml) olive oil
1 tablespoon (15 ml) apple cider vinegar
1 tablespoon (15 ml) freshly squeezed lime juice
3 tablespoons (45 ml) of water
4 cups chopped romaine (from one 10-ounce head)
1 red or yellow bell pepper, sliced
8 ounces cherry or grape tomatoes
1 cup thinly sliced red onion
7 ounces halloumi, sliced lengthwise
Directions:
1. Scoop the WHOLLY GUACAMOLE® into a large jar with a tight fitting lid. Add olive oil, apple cider vinegar, lime juice, and 3 tablespoons water. Secure lid and shake vigorously, until fully combined and creamy (but still quite thick). Set aside.
2. Put romaine, pepper, tomatoes, and onion in a large salad bowl.
3. Pat halloumi dry. Spray a grill pan or cast iron skillet with cooking spray and heat over high heat. Add halloumi and cook over high heat, about 2 minutes per side until starting to soften (press down with a spatula for grill marks). Transfer to a cutting board and cut into bite-sized pieces.
4. Add grilled halloumi to salad bowl and toss with the Wholly Guacamole Vinaigrette until well coated. Serve immediately.
